* refactor(wizard): rebuild project creation flow as modular TypeScript components
Replace the monolithic `ProjectCreationWizard.jsx` with a feature-based TS
implementation under `src/components/project-creation-wizard`, while preserving
existing behavior and improving readability, maintainability, and state isolation.
Why:
- The previous wizard mixed API logic, flow state, folder browsing, and UI in one file.
- Refactoring and testing were difficult due to tightly coupled concerns.
- We needed stronger type safety and localized component state.
What changed:
- Deleted:
- `src/components/ProjectCreationWizard.jsx`
- Added new modular structure:
- `src/components/project-creation-wizard/index.ts`
- `src/components/project-creation-wizard/ProjectCreationWizard.tsx`
- `src/components/project-creation-wizard/types.ts`
- `src/components/project-creation-wizard/data/workspaceApi.ts`
- `src/components/project-creation-wizard/hooks/useGithubTokens.ts`
- `src/components/project-creation-wizard/utils/pathUtils.ts`
- `src/components/project-creation-wizard/components/*`
- `WizardProgress`, `WizardFooter`, `ErrorBanner`
- `StepTypeSelection`, `StepConfiguration`, `StepReview`
- `WorkspacePathField`, `GithubAuthenticationCard`, `FolderBrowserModal`
- Updated import usage:
- `src/components/sidebar/view/subcomponents/SidebarModals.tsx`
now imports from `../../../project-creation-wizard`.
Implementation details:
- Migrated wizard logic to TypeScript using `type` aliases only.
- Kept component prop types colocated in each component file.
- Split responsibilities by feature:
- container/orchestration in `ProjectCreationWizard.tsx`
- API/SSE and request parsing in `data/workspaceApi.ts`
- GitHub token loading/caching behavior in `useGithubTokens`
- path/URL helpers in `utils/pathUtils.ts`
- Localized UI-only state to child components:
- folder browser modal state (current path, hidden folders, create-folder input)
- path suggestion dropdown state with debounced lookup
- Preserved existing UX flows:
- step navigation and validation
- existing/new workspace modes
- optional GitHub clone + auth modes
- clone progress via SSE
- folder browsing + folder creation
- Added focused comments for non-obvious logic (debounce, SSE auth constraint, path edge cases).
* refactor(quick-settings): migrate panel to typed feature-based modules
Refactor QuickSettingsPanel from a single JSX component into a modular TypeScript feature structure while preserving behavior and translations.
Highlights:
- Replace legacy src/components/QuickSettingsPanel.jsx with a typed entrypoint (src/components/QuickSettingsPanel.tsx).
- Introduce src/components/quick-settings-panel/ with clear separation of concerns:
- view/: panel shell, header, handle, section wrappers, toggle rows, and content sections.
- hooks/: drag interactions and whisper mode persistence.
- constants.ts and types.ts for shared config and strict local typing.
- Move drag logic into useQuickSettingsDrag with explicit touch/mouse handling, drag threshold detection, click suppression after drag, position clamping, and localStorage persistence.
- Keep user-visible behavior intact:
- same open/close panel interactions.
- same mobile/desktop drag behavior and persisted handle position.
- same quick preference toggles and wiring to useUiPreferences.
- same hidden whisper section behavior and localStorage/event updates.
- Improve readability and maintainability by extracting repetitive setting rows and section scaffolding into reusable components.
- Add focused comments around non-obvious behavior (drag click suppression, touch scroll lock, hidden whisper section intent).
- Keep files small and reviewable (all new/changed files are under 300 lines).
Validation:
- npm run typecheck
- npm run build

* refactor(prd-editor): modularize PRD editor with typed feature modules
Break the legacy PRDEditor.jsx monolith into a feature-based TypeScript architecture under src/components/prd-editor while keeping behavior parity and readability.
Key changes:
- Replace PRDEditor.jsx with a typed orchestrator component and a compatibility export bridge at src/components/PRDEditor.tsx.
- Split responsibilities into dedicated hooks: document loading/init, existing PRD registry fetching, save workflow with overwrite detection, and keyboard shortcuts.
- Split UI into focused view components: header, editor/preview body, footer stats, loading state, generate-tasks modal, and overwrite-confirm modal.
- Move filename concerns into utility helpers (sanitize, extension handling, default naming) and centralize template/constants.
- Keep component-local state close to the UI that owns it (workspace controls/modal toggles), while shared workflow state remains in the feature container.
- Reuse the existing MarkdownPreview component for safer markdown rendering instead of ad-hoc HTML conversion.
- Update TaskMasterPanel integration to consume typed PRDEditor directly (remove any-cast) and pass isExisting metadata for correct overwrite behavior.
- Keep all new/changed files below 300 lines and add targeted comments where behavior needs clarification.
Validation:
- npm run typecheck
- npm run build
